Unemployment Rate: Ages 16-24 was 9.7 as of 2024-08-01, according to U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ics. Historically, Unemployment Rate: Ages 16-24 reached a record high of 27.4 and a record low of 4.8, the median value is 11.6. Typical value range is from 7 to 12.9. The Year-Over-Year growth is 12.75%. GuruFocus provides the current actual value, an historical data chart and related indicators for Unemployment Rate: Ages 16-24 - last updated on 2024-08-01.
Monthly , seasonally adjusted . The series comes from the 'Current Population Survey (Household Survey)' The source code is: LNS14024887
